Just downloaded the PADI app. I am not a dive professional; highest cert is Rescue. I have no eCards probably because my last cert (Deep Diver) was a few years ago... but I really don't know. If I want an eCard, it's $53 for a standard eCard for each certification or specialty. eCards with artwork are $63 each.

Not gonna happen for something less useful than a physical card. eCards can't be accessed without internet access according to PADI.

Also, to replace a physical card is $53 per cert or specialty and $63 per card with artwork.
